Constitution Day at Tappan Middle School

Betsey Wiegman, one of the University of Michigan Law School chapter's members, spent an afternoon at Karen Tuttle's sixth grade history class at Tappan Middle School in Ann Arbor, Michigan. Betsey based her outstanding PowerPoint presentation (including a thought experiment where the kids pretended they were stranded on a tropical island and had to create their own society's rules) on lessons developed by the national ACS organization. The kids were totally engaged, and they had a great time learning about our Constitution.
